## v1.7.0 — Restock planner

- VendaPlan now groups restock routes by zone instead of machine age.
- Fixed double-counting of reserved slots in the Harlow depot forecast.
- Planner exports are deterministic; safe to diff between runs.

Release manager: hold the rollout if forecast variance exceeds 5%. Sign-off authority rests with the engineer named below.

account owner for fajep-yagef: Kasix Eliiel

Ticket: ScaleSpoon staging is pointing at the wrong pantry service

Hey on-call — the recipe-scaling calculator (ScaleSpoon) started returning 401s after last night's env shuffle. Looks like someone copied the prod file over staging, so the ingredient-conversion API rejects every request. Tamsin confirmed the fix is just restoring the staging env and re-adding the conversion service credential. Paste the correct secret on the line immediately below this sentence.

sealed setting: VAULT_KEY20=c8ea1e419912889df6b4

Nice cleanup on the retry path! One thing before I approve: the Parcelwise webhook handler now retries on any 5xx, but the carrier sandbox sometimes returns 503 for minutes at a stretch, so we really want exponential backoff with a hard ceiling rather than the fixed delay here. Also worth pulling the magic numbers out of the loop body so future maintainers (hi, future us) can tune without re-reading the whole function. I'd suggest we standardize on the following constants:

tuning table, faduf-baduf:
PRIORITIES = {
    "ulavan": 191,
    "silys": 750,
    "goriel": 238,
    "kelmir": 66,
    "wendor": 432,
}